Listing the Switch’s Current Authorized IP Manager(s)
Use the show ip authorized-managers command to list IP stations authorized to
access the switch. For example:
ProCurve(config)# show ip authorized-manager
IPV4 Authorized Managers
Address : 10.10.10.10
Mask : 255.255.255.255
Access : Manager
Figure 14-3. Example of show authorized-managers Command
Configuring IP Authorized Managers for the Switch
See the IPv6 Configuration Guide for information about Authorized IP
manager configuration with IPv6 addresses.
Syntax: [no] ip authorized-managers <ip-address> <ip-mask>> access [manager
| operator]
[no] ipv6 authorized-managers <ip-address> <ip-mask> access [manager
| operator]
Configures one or more authorized IP addresses.
